Chandanpur Village - Pakhanjur, Uttar Bastar Kanker

Chandanpur is a village situated in the Pakhanjur tehsil of Uttar Bastar Kanker district, Chhattisgarh. It is located approximately 18 km from the tehsil headquarters in Pakhanjur and around 147 km from the district headquarters in Kanker. Chandanpur village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Chandanpur is 448277. The village covers a total geographical area of 394 hectares and falls under the 494776 pincode. Pakhanjur is the nearest town, located about 18 km away.

Chandanp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Antagarh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kanker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Chandanpur

As per Census 2011, Chandanpur village has a total population of 990 people, consisting of 532 males and 458 females. The village has 189 households and a sex ratio of 860 females per 1,000 males. There are 144 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 697 literate and 293 illiterate residents. Additionally, 3 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Chandanpur

Chandanp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Dalli Rajhara, while the nearest airport is Jagdalpur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 133.7 km.
